Why Political Stability Matters

Political stability creates an environment where governments can focus on development instead of continuous political uncertainty. When policies remain consistent, businesses gain confidence to invest, international partners strengthen economic cooperation, and public institutions work more efficiently.

For Pakistan, stability is especially important because the country is working to improve its economy, expand infrastructure, create employment opportunities, and strengthen public services. These goals require long-term planning that is difficult to achieve during periods of political unrest.

A stable political system also allows provincial and federal governments to work together on issues such as education, healthcare, energy, and economic reforms.

Economic Growth Depends on Strong Governance

The economy and politics are closely connected. Investors often evaluate a country’s political environment before making major business decisions. When policies remain predictable and institutions function effectively, investment becomes more attractive.

Pakistan has significant economic potential due to its strategic location, young workforce, agricultural resources, and growing technology sector. By improving governance and maintaining policy continuity, the country can create more opportunities for local businesses and encourage foreign investment.

Economic development also supports job creation, reduces poverty, and improves the overall quality of life for millions of people.

The Role of Democratic Institutions

Strong democratic institutions are the foundation of every successful democracy. Parliament, the judiciary, election authorities, and independent public institutions all contribute to maintaining balance within the political system.

Citizens expect these institutions to operate fairly, transparently, and according to the Constitution. Public trust increases when decisions are made through proper legal and democratic processes.

Political parties also have an important responsibility. Healthy debate, constructive criticism, and cooperation on national issues can strengthen democracy while ensuring that different viewpoints are represented.

Youth Participation in Politics

Pakistan has one of the youngest populations in the world. This presents both an opportunity and a responsibility. Young people are becoming increasingly interested in public policy, governance, entrepreneurship, and national development.

Through education, civic engagement, and responsible participation, young citizens can contribute to shaping Pakistan’s future. Social media and digital platforms have also made political discussions more accessible, allowing citizens to stay informed and express their opinions.

At the same time, it is important to verify information from reliable sources before sharing it online. Responsible digital citizenship helps reduce misinformation and promotes informed public discussion.

Challenges That Require Collective Efforts

Pakistan continues to face several important challenges, including inflation, unemployment, energy demands, climate-related risks, education reforms, and healthcare improvements. Addressing these issues requires cooperation among government institutions, policymakers, businesses, and civil society.

Rather than focusing only on political differences, national attention can also be directed toward practical solutions that improve everyday life for citizens. Long-term planning, evidence-based policymaking, and accountability can help achieve meaningful progress.
